Cook's Fort

Constructed circa 1770 on land owned by Valentine Cook on Indian Creek, Cook's Fort was one of the largest frontier forts on the western line of settlement and provided a very strong defensive post. The fort covered over an acre and had four blockhouses. It sheltered 300 people during Native American attacks of 1778 and was actively used through the early 1780's. Several settlers, unable to reach the fort, were killed here.
